ingredients
- 3 lbs ground beef
- 4 (16 ounce) cans pork and beans
- 2 cups ketchup
- 1 cup water
- 2 (1 1/4 ounce) envelopes onion soup mix
- 1⁄4 cup brown sugar, packed
- 1⁄4 cup ground mustard
- 1⁄4 cup molasses
- 1 tablespoon white vinegar
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1⁄2 teaspoon ground cloves
directions
- In a Dutch oven, cook beef over medium heat and drain.
- Stir in the pork and beans, ketchup, water, onion soup mix, brown sugar, mustard, molasses, vinegar, garlic powder, and ground cloves.
- Heat through.
- Transfer to two greased 2-quart baking dishes.
- Cover and freeze one dish for up to 3 months.
- Cover and bake the second dish at 400 degrees Fahrenheit for 30 minutes.
- Uncover and bake 10 to 15 minutes longer or until bubbly.
- To use frozen casserole: Thaw in the refrigerator. Cover and bake at 400 degrees Fahrenheit for 40 minutes. Uncover and bake 15 to 20 minutes longer or until bubbly.
